Foundation Leak Repair in Tuscaloosa, AL
Foundation leak repair services address issues related to water infiltration through cracks or gaps in a property's foundation. These services typically cover projects such as sealing foundation cracks, installing waterproof barriers, and applying drainage solutions to prevent water from seeping into basements or crawl spaces. Homeowners considering this service often want to understand the signs of foundation leaks, including damp or moldy areas, musty odors, or visible cracks, as well as the potential causes like poor drainage or soil movement around the foundation.
Before requesting foundation leak repairs, property owners should assess the extent of water intrusion and consider any related structural concerns. It's important to evaluate whether symptoms are localized or widespread and to understand the underlying issues contributing to the leaks. Clarifying the scope of work needed and any existing drainage or grading problems can help ensure the repair process effectively addresses the root cause and protects the property from future water damage.

Common Foundation Leak Repair Jobs
Foundation crack repairs - sealing cracks to prevent water intrusion and structural damage.
Leak detection and assessment - identifying hidden leaks that may compromise the foundation.
Waterproofing services - applying sealants and coatings to keep basements dry and protected.
Drainage system repairs - fixing or installing drainage solutions to divert water away from the foundation.
Soil stabilization - improving soil conditions around the foundation to reduce shifting and settling.
Foundation leveling - correcting uneven settlement to maintain stability and prevent further damage.
Foundation Leak Repair Questions
What causes foundation leaks? Foundation leaks often result from soil movement, poor drainage, or cracks in the foundation allowing water intrusion.
How can I tell if my foundation has a leak? Signs include damp or stained basement walls, mold growth, or a musty odor in the property.
Is foundation leak repair necessary? Yes, addressing leaks promptly helps prevent structural damage and further water-related issues.
What methods are used to repair foundation leaks? Repairs may involve sealing cracks, installing waterproof barriers, or improving drainage systems around the property.
